ABOUT THE AWARDS
The Legacy Youth Awards is our flagship recognition programme – but it's much more than trophies and certificates. It's a statement that young people's achievements matter, that their struggles deserve recognition, and that their futures are full of possibility.
The awards are designed and delivered by young people themselves. From category design to event planning, youth voice is at the heart of everything we do. This isn't an awards programme for young people – it's an awards programme by young people.
Youth-Led Design
Our Youth Advisory Board co-designs every aspect of the awards, ensuring the programme remains authentic, relevant, & meaningful to young people today.
